近年、インターネット技術の継続的な発展に伴い、PHP の負荷分散技術も進化を続けています。 PHP 編集者の Baicao は、イノベーションを受け入れることがパフォーマンス向上の鍵であると信じています。従来のハードウェア負荷分散から最新のソフトウェア負荷分散ソリューションまで、革新的なテクノロジーを通じて PHP アプリケーションのパフォーマンスを最適化する方法に注目する企業が増えています。この記事では、PHP ロード バランシングの最新トレンドを紹介し、革新的なテクノロジを適用して PHP アプリケーションのパフォーマンスを向上させる方法を探ります。
従来のポーリングアルゴリズム (加重ポーリングや最小接続数ポーリングなど) は、依然として広く使用されています。ただし、新しいアルゴリズムは、よりきめ細かい制御と 最適化 を提供します。たとえば、 優先度ポーリング を使用すると、管理者はさまざまなリクエストに重みを割り当てることができます。また、 応答時間ベースのポーリング では、 サーバー の応答時間に基づいてリクエストの割り当てを動的に調整できます。 。
リーリーハッシュ アルゴリズムの力を活用する
ハッシュ アルゴリズムは、リクエストを特定のサーバーに分散することで、スループットと キャッシュ 効率を向上させます。 一貫性のあるハッシュ このアルゴリズムは、ハッシュ関数を使用してリクエストをハッシュし、その結果に基づいてリクエストを所定のサーバーにルーティングします。このアプローチにより、リクエストが常に同じサーバーにルーティングされるようになり、ヒット率が向上し、待ち時間が短縮されます。
リーリーAI を導入して負荷分散を最適化する
人工知能 (ai) テクノロジーは、負荷分散の状況を完全に変えています。 機械学習アルゴリズムは、リクエスト パターン、サーバー メトリクス、パフォーマンス データを分析し、サーバー割り当てを動的に調整して全体的なパフォーマンスを最適化できます。これにより、手動構成の必要性がなくなり、トラフィック パターンが変化する場合でも継続的な最適化が保証されます。
コンテナ化とクラウド コンピューティングの統合
コンテナ化 テクノロジーと クラウド コンピューティング プラットフォームの台頭により、負荷分散の管理と展開が簡素化されました。コンテナ化により、アプリケーションと依存関係を軽量コンテナにパッケージ化できる一方、クラウド プラットフォームでは自動スケーリング、負荷分散、監視機能が提供されます。これにより、スケーラブルで 高可用性の PHP アプリケーションを簡単に作成できるようになります。
ベスト プラクティス ガイド
WEB アプリケーションの高いパフォーマンス、スケーラビリティ、および信頼性を確保するには、PHP 負荷分散の最新トレンドを採用することが重要です。多様なポーリング アルゴリズム、強力なハッシュ アルゴリズム、AI の最適化、コンテナ化、クラウド統合により、負荷分散戦略を最適化し、ユーザーに優れたエクスペリエンスを提供できます。
以上がPHP ロード バランシングの最新トレンド: パフォーマンスを向上させるためのイノベーションの採用の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。